Overview

An Activity Therapist designs and implements therapeutic activities that promote emotional, physical, and social well-being. They often work with individuals facing mental health issues, physical disabilities, or aging-related challenges. These activities may include arts, games, music, or outdoor exercises. The focus is to improve overall quality of life and enhance daily functioning. They work in hospitals, nursing homes, or community health programs.

Job Description
  • Plan and lead therapeutic activities tailored to client needs.
  • Assess participant interests, abilities, and needs.
  • Collaborate with healthcare professionals to track patient progress.
  • Encourage patient participation and social interaction.
  • Use recreational techniques to support rehabilitation goals.
  • Document session outcomes and adjust activities accordingly.
  • Promote a safe and engaging therapeutic environment.
